Looks like airbnb had a pretty nice earnings report for Q1. What's notable is Brian Chesky mentioning how he is taking note of guests complaining about the rising fees and costs. I take this as a way to read that airbnb will soon find another way to make it more miserable for hosts in favor of guests.. we all know guests can submit any sort of complaint on hosts and hosts have no way to defend themselves against fake claims. Perhaps airbnb should reevalute their insane booking % they take from guests to cut down on the fees..
